/**
* Produces a GraphQL Value AST given a JavaScript object.
* Function will match JavaScript/JSON values to GraphQL AST schema format
* by using suggested GraphQLInputType.
*
* A GraphQL type must be provided, which will be used to interpret different
* JavaScript values.
*
* | JSON Value | GraphQL Value |
* | ------------- | -------------------- |
* | Object | Input Object |
* | Array | List |
* | Boolean | Boolean |
* | String | String / Enum Value |
* | Number | Int / Float |
* | Unknown | Enum Value |
* | null | NullValue |
* @param value - Runtime value to convert.
* @param type - The GraphQL type to inspect.
* @returns A GraphQL value AST for the provided JavaScript value, or null when no literal can represent it.
* @example
* ```ts
* import { print } from 'graphql/language';
* import {
* GraphQLInputObjectType,
* GraphQLInt,
* GraphQLList,
* GraphQLNonNull,
* GraphQLString,
* } from 'graphql/type';
* import { astFromValue } from 'graphql/utilities';
*
* const ReviewInput = new GraphQLInputObjectType({
* name: 'ReviewInput',
* fields: {
* stars: { type: new GraphQLNonNull(GraphQLInt) },
* tags: { type: new GraphQLList(GraphQLString) },
* },
* });
*
* const valueNode = astFromValue(
* { stars: 5, tags: ['featured', 'verified'] },
* ReviewInput,
* );
*
* print(valueNode); // => '{ stars: 5, tags: ["featured", "verified"] }'
* astFromValue(undefined, GraphQLString); // => null
* astFromValue(null, new GraphQLNonNull(GraphQLString)); // => null
* ```
*/
export function astFromValue(
value: unknown,
type: GraphQLInputType,
): Maybe<ValueNode> {
if (isNonNullType(type)) {
const astValue = astFromValue(value, type.ofType);
if (astValue?.kind === Kind.NULL) {
return null;
}
return astValue;
}
// only explicit null, not undefined, NaN
if (value === null) {
return { kind: Kind.NULL };
}
// undefined
if (value === undefined) {
return null;
}
// Convert JavaScript array to GraphQL list. If the GraphQLType is a list, but
// the value is not an array, convert the value using the list's item type.
if (isListType(type)) {
const itemType = type.ofType;
if (isIterableObject(value)) {
const valuesNodes = [];
for (const item of value) {
const itemNode = astFromValue(item, itemType);
if (itemNode != null) {
valuesNodes.push(itemNode);
}
}
return { kind: Kind.LIST, values: valuesNodes };
}
return astFromValue(value, itemType);
}
// Populate the fields of the input object by creating ASTs from each value
// in the JavaScript object according to the fields in the input type.
if (isInputObjectType(type)) {
if (!isObjectLike(value)) {
return null;
}
const fieldNodes: Array<ObjectFieldNode> = [];
for (const field of Object.values(type.getFields())) {
const fieldValue = astFromValue(value[field.name], field.type);
if (fieldValue) {
fieldNodes.push({
kind: Kind.OBJECT_FIELD,
name: { kind: Kind.NAME, value: field.name },
value: fieldValue,
});
}
}
return { kind: Kind.OBJECT, fields: fieldNodes };
}
if (isLeafType(type)) {
// Since value is an internally represented value, it must be serialized
// to an externally represented value before converting into an AST.
const serialized = type.serialize(value);
if (serialized == null) {
return null;
}
// Others serialize based on their corresponding JavaScript scalar types.
if (typeof serialized === 'boolean') {
return { kind: Kind.BOOLEAN, value: serialized };
}
// JavaScript numbers can be Int or Float values.
if (typeof serialized === 'number' && Number.isFinite(serialized)) {
const stringNum = String(serialized);
return integerStringRegExp.test(stringNum)
? { kind: Kind.INT, value: stringNum }
: { kind: Kind.FLOAT, value: stringNum };
}
if (typeof serialized === 'string') {
// Enum types use Enum literals.
if (isEnumType(type)) {
return { kind: Kind.ENUM, value: serialized };
}
// ID types can use Int literals.
if (type === GraphQLID && integerStringRegExp.test(serialized)) {
return { kind: Kind.INT, value: serialized };
}
return {
kind: Kind.STRING,
value: serialized,
};
}
throw new TypeError(`Cannot convert value to AST: ${inspect(serialized)}.`);
}
/* c8 ignore next 3 */
// Not reachable, all possible types have been considered.
invariant(false, 'Unexpected input type: ' + inspect(type));
}
/**
* IntValue:
* - NegativeSign? 0
* - NegativeSign? NonZeroDigit ( Digit+ )?
*
* @internal
*/
const integerStringRegExp = /^-?(?:0|[1-9][0-9]*)$/;
